She had been watching Stella Hopkins for a while- from where she sat at the other end of the bar, and also in general. She knew Hopkins was trying to make a name for herself and figured that Sherlock Holmes could be a good way to do that; either she would come out the other side of it or she wouldn’t. Sally hoped it would be the former, obviously- but she saw hints of the latter in the speed at which Hopkins had been drinking all night.
